The position:
Conduct materials sampling and testing with precision, integrity, expediency, and in a safe manner. All tasks performed must align with the Walbec Group Quality Management System requirements, Walbec Group policies, standard operating procedures, ethical standards, the Quality Control Technician Manual, and relevant agency specifications, regulations, policies, methods, and procedures

Responsibilities:

  • Perform sampling and standardized testing according to AASHTO, ASTM, and/or customer specifications.

  • Strictly adhere to the Standard Operating Procedures (SOP) for all tasks.

  • Attain basic understanding of binder grading system.

  • Complete accurate standard mathematical computations per the testing procedure(s).

  • Input data into Laboratory Information Management system (LIMS).

  • Accurately communicate and document test results to relevant internal and external stakeholders.

  • Document all sampling, testing, and subsequent actions taken.

  • Analyze test outcomes and assist in making necessary process control adjustments.

  • Ensure equipment functionality and timely calibrations as per schedule.

  • Oversee regular equipment maintenance and ensure malfunctioning equipment is marked out of service.

  • Uphold a professional standard of cleanliness and maintenance for all equipment and facilities.

  • Engage professionally with both internal and external stakeholders.

  • Value safety and ethics in all tasks.

  • Undertake any other duties as assigned.
